Built for moromi, not just for a spec sheet

Soy sauce fermentation depends on a living system: koji condition, raw material quality, salt balance, temperature profile, tank geometry, and time. Supplemental enzymes must fit into that system with care.

Moromi Pulse supports enzyme programs for breweries looking to improve process control while respecting established flavor standards. Our focus is not aggressive intervention. It is measured support where enzymes can help the mash behave more predictably.

Where Moromi Pulse helps fermentation teams

More consistent nitrogen release

Protein breakdown influences umami depth, soluble nitrogen development, and overall flavor architecture. Moromi Pulse helps breweries evaluate enzyme approaches that support steadier nitrogen release across soybean lots, roast profiles, and seasonal production shifts.

Controlled flavor development

The goal is not a one-dimensional boost. Soy sauce flavor depends on balance: savory depth, aroma precursors, color development, salt integration, and clean finish. We help teams assess enzyme impact against sensory targets and existing quality benchmarks.

Better mash viscosity management

Moromi that becomes difficult to pump, mix, sample, or press can create hidden production losses. Enzyme support can help reduce viscosity pressure points, improve liquor movement, and support more predictable handling through the fermentation and separation stages.

Fermentation time planning

Many breweries are not trying to make the fastest possible soy sauce. They are trying to plan capacity with confidence. A well-matched enzyme strategy can help reduce process variability and give production teams a tighter operating window for tank scheduling.

Cleaner filtration and liquid recovery

Downstream behavior matters. Mash structure, suspended solids, and soluble load all influence pressing, clarification, and filtration. Moromi Pulse helps customers evaluate enzyme use with the full plant flow in mind, not only the fermentation tank.

Dosage discipline and scale-up control

Small changes can create real consequences in soy sauce fermentation. Moromi Pulse supports practical dose-range trials, process observation, sensory review, and staged scale-up so breweries can make decisions based on plant evidence rather than guesswork.
